mirror of
https://github.com/munin-monitoring/contrib.git
synced 2018-11-08 00:59:34 +01:00
Fix to remove ${sqlplus_opts} to supress shellcheck warnings
This commit is contained in:
parent
3e4a48abb8
commit
99e235ceef
1 changed files with 17 additions and 18 deletions
|
@ -464,8 +464,7 @@ getvalue_func[$key]=getvalue_asmusage
|
||||||
# End of Graph Settings
|
# End of Graph Settings
|
||||||
|
|
||||||
# sqlplus options
|
# sqlplus options
|
||||||
: ${sqlplus:=sqlplus}
|
: "${sqlplus:=sqlplus -S -L}"
|
||||||
: ${sqlplus_opts:=-S -L}
|
|
||||||
sqlplus_variables="
|
sqlplus_variables="
|
||||||
set pagesize 0
|
set pagesize 0
|
||||||
set feed off
|
set feed off
|
||||||
|
@ -531,7 +530,7 @@ getvalue_sysstat() {
|
||||||
[ -z "$field" ] && continue
|
[ -z "$field" ] && continue
|
||||||
label="${t[3]}"
|
label="${t[3]}"
|
||||||
|
|
||||||
${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
VAR vf VARCHAR2(64)
|
VAR vf VARCHAR2(64)
|
||||||
VAR vl VARCHAR2(64)
|
VAR vl VARCHAR2(64)
|
||||||
|
@ -556,7 +555,7 @@ getvalue_sgainfo() {
|
||||||
[ -z "$field" ] && continue
|
[ -z "$field" ] && continue
|
||||||
label="${t[3]}"
|
label="${t[3]}"
|
||||||
|
|
||||||
${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
VAR vf VARCHAR2(64)
|
VAR vf VARCHAR2(64)
|
||||||
VAR vl VARCHAR2(64)
|
VAR vl VARCHAR2(64)
|
||||||
|
@ -581,7 +580,7 @@ getvalue_pgastat() {
|
||||||
[ -z "$field" ] && continue
|
[ -z "$field" ] && continue
|
||||||
label="${t[3]}"
|
label="${t[3]}"
|
||||||
|
|
||||||
${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
VAR vf VARCHAR2(64)
|
VAR vf VARCHAR2(64)
|
||||||
VAR vl VARCHAR2(64)
|
VAR vl VARCHAR2(64)
|
||||||
|
@ -598,7 +597,7 @@ EOF
|
||||||
}
|
}
|
||||||
|
|
||||||
getvalue_cachehit() {
|
getvalue_cachehit() {
|
||||||
${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
SELECT
|
SELECT
|
||||||
'buf_hitratio.value ' || ROUND( ( 1 - a.value / ( b.value + c.value ) ) * 100 )
|
'buf_hitratio.value ' || ROUND( ( 1 - a.value / ( b.value + c.value ) ) * 100 )
|
||||||
|
@ -623,7 +622,7 @@ EOF
|
||||||
}
|
}
|
||||||
|
|
||||||
getfield_sessionuser() {
|
getfield_sessionuser() {
|
||||||
data_attrs[$module]="$( ${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
data_attrs[$module]="$( ${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
SELECT
|
SELECT
|
||||||
REGEXP_REPLACE( username,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) ||
|
REGEXP_REPLACE( username,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) ||
|
||||||
|
@ -639,7 +638,7 @@ EOF
|
||||||
}
|
}
|
||||||
|
|
||||||
getvalue_sessionuser() {
|
getvalue_sessionuser() {
|
||||||
${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
SELECT
|
SELECT
|
||||||
REGEXP_REPLACE( du.username,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) || '.value ' ||
|
REGEXP_REPLACE( du.username,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) || '.value ' ||
|
||||||
|
@ -661,7 +660,7 @@ EOF
|
||||||
}
|
}
|
||||||
|
|
||||||
getfield_sessionwait() {
|
getfield_sessionwait() {
|
||||||
data_attrs[$module]="$( ${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
data_attrs[$module]="$( ${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
SELECT
|
SELECT
|
||||||
REGEXP_REPLACE( wait_class,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) ||
|
REGEXP_REPLACE( wait_class,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) ||
|
||||||
|
@ -681,7 +680,7 @@ EOF
|
||||||
}
|
}
|
||||||
|
|
||||||
getvalue_sessionwait() {
|
getvalue_sessionwait() {
|
||||||
${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
SELECT
|
SELECT
|
||||||
REGEXP_REPLACE( en.wait_class,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) || '.value ' ||
|
REGEXP_REPLACE( en.wait_class,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) || '.value ' ||
|
||||||
|
@ -704,7 +703,7 @@ EOF
|
||||||
}
|
}
|
||||||
|
|
||||||
getfield_eventwait() {
|
getfield_eventwait() {
|
||||||
data_attrs[$module]="$( ${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
data_attrs[$module]="$( ${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
SELECT
|
SELECT
|
||||||
REGEXP_REPLACE( wait_class,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) ||
|
REGEXP_REPLACE( wait_class,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) ||
|
||||||
|
@ -723,7 +722,7 @@ EOF
|
||||||
}
|
}
|
||||||
|
|
||||||
getvalue_eventwait() {
|
getvalue_eventwait() {
|
||||||
${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
SELECT
|
SELECT
|
||||||
REGEXP_REPLACE( en.wait_class,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) || '.value ' ||
|
REGEXP_REPLACE( en.wait_class,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) || '.value ' ||
|
||||||
|
@ -749,7 +748,7 @@ EOF
|
||||||
getfield_eventwait2() {
|
getfield_eventwait2() {
|
||||||
local waitclass="$1"
|
local waitclass="$1"
|
||||||
|
|
||||||
data_attrs[$module]="$( ${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
data_attrs[$module]="$( ${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
VAR vl VARCHAR2(64)
|
VAR vl VARCHAR2(64)
|
||||||
EXEC :vl := '${waitclass}'
|
EXEC :vl := '${waitclass}'
|
||||||
|
@ -769,7 +768,7 @@ EOF
|
||||||
getvalue_eventwait2() {
|
getvalue_eventwait2() {
|
||||||
local waitclass="$1"
|
local waitclass="$1"
|
||||||
|
|
||||||
${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
VAR vl VARCHAR2(64)
|
VAR vl VARCHAR2(64)
|
||||||
EXEC :vl := '${waitclass}'
|
EXEC :vl := '${waitclass}'
|
||||||
|
@ -786,7 +785,7 @@ EOF
|
||||||
}
|
}
|
||||||
|
|
||||||
getfield_tablespace() {
|
getfield_tablespace() {
|
||||||
data_attrs[$module]="$( ${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
data_attrs[$module]="$( ${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
SELECT
|
SELECT
|
||||||
REGEXP_REPLACE( tablespace_name,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) ||
|
REGEXP_REPLACE( tablespace_name,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) ||
|
||||||
|
@ -800,7 +799,7 @@ EOF
|
||||||
}
|
}
|
||||||
|
|
||||||
getvalue_tablespace() {
|
getvalue_tablespace() {
|
||||||
${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
SELECT
|
SELECT
|
||||||
REGEXP_REPLACE( tablespace_name,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) || '.value ' ||
|
REGEXP_REPLACE( tablespace_name,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) || '.value ' ||
|
||||||
|
@ -828,7 +827,7 @@ EOF
|
||||||
}
|
}
|
||||||
|
|
||||||
getfield_asmusage() {
|
getfield_asmusage() {
|
||||||
data_attrs[$module]="$( ${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
data_attrs[$module]="$( ${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
SELECT
|
SELECT
|
||||||
REGEXP_REPLACE( name,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) ||
|
REGEXP_REPLACE( name,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) ||
|
||||||
|
@ -842,7 +841,7 @@ EOF
|
||||||
}
|
}
|
||||||
|
|
||||||
getvalue_asmusage() {
|
getvalue_asmusage() {
|
||||||
${sqlplus} ${sqlplus_opts} "${oracle_auth}" <<EOF
|
${sqlplus} "${oracle_auth}" <<EOF
|
||||||
${sqlplus_variables}
|
${sqlplus_variables}
|
||||||
SELECT
|
SELECT
|
||||||
REGEXP_REPLACE( name,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) || '.value ' ||
|
REGEXP_REPLACE( name, '^[^A-Za-z_]|[^A-Za-z0-9_]', '_' ) || '.value ' ||
|
||||||
|
|
Loading…
Reference in a new issue